Sustainable landscaping highlights ecologically responsible practices that save resources, decrease waste, and promote biodiversity. Key strategies include picking native or drought-tolerant plants, carrying out efficient irrigation systems, and utilizing organic or slow-release fertilizers. Sustainable landscapes reduce chemical inputs, lower water usage, and support local wildlife. Design factors to consider integrate natural features, such as rain gardens, permeable pavements, and mulched areas, to handle stormwater and reduce runoff. Incorporating composting and soil changes improves soil health while minimizing dependency on external inputs. Thoughtful plant positioning and layering likewise develop microclimates, assisting to conserve energy and protect plants from extreme conditions. With time, sustainable landscaping decreases maintenance expenses while improving long-lasting resilience. Beyond ecological advantages, these landscapes provide aesthetic value and enhanced functionality, developing areas that are both lovely and ecologically accountable
